Output 76de495a4b78cbf50965d269a56b6832aeab888b1b99f200edd1ade3efda91fc:8

value
58174955
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84b59eb4a4164e5d8cd4424b63fcd846b2b95874 OP_EQUAL
address
MKzrzvhnBcwQgXAiDWhaFZC4fWEhaTLhHB
transaction
76de495a4b78cbf50965d269a56b6832aeab888b1b99f200edd1ade3efda91fc
spent
true